Agriculture has an important role in today’s society and contributes significantly to the environment. The rise of agriculture has resulted in environmental degradation in transportation, food consumption, and production since carbon levels are high, and agriculture produces more fossil fuels, which impact the atmosphere. The use of green technology or smart farming solutions for agriculture has increased to make the environment more sustainable. According to a study, the global green technology and sustainability market is expected to grow at a CAGR of 20.6% between 2022 and 2029, from $13.76 billion to $51.09 billion.
The agricultural sector can be improved by leveraging technology to achieve SDG and benefit farmers and businesses by making sustainable decisions and achieving better agricultural yields. The agricultural sector has started to adopt green technologies like organic agriculture, drone fleet management, digital sensors, agricultural robots, irrigation, zero tillage, integrated pest management and renewable energy to protect the environment. According to a study, the market for drones in smart agriculture will grow from $1.2 billion in 2019 to $4.8 billion in 2024.
What is Green Technology?
Green technology mainly focuses on preventing the environment from the negative impacts of humans. Green technology holds more benefits because it assists in sustainable agricultural development, reduces environmental damage, and produces low-fossil fuel, which acts as a by-product. Renewable Energy:
#1 Biomass:
Biological organisms such as animal and plant waste are referred to as biomass, and this material is converted to generate energy by the burning process. The outcome is used for drying crops, dairy operations, generating electricity, heating buildings and producing steam.#2 Solar:
The agricultural sector requires solar energy to convert solar light radiation into electrical energy. The electricity generated from the sun allows farmers to have access to water pumps, run farm machinery and lighting for crops.#3 Solar Thermal:
It is also a green technology widely preferred by farmers and businesses to convert solar energy into heat energy for common uses like solar greenhouses, water heating, and underground soil heating.#4 Wind:
Wind turbines are an excellent choice for farmers to pump water for irrigation.-
